Bio
Ruby Ramsay is currently a undergraduate student pursuing a degree in computer science at the University of Massachusetts Amherst. During her time in Amherst so far, she has started a TEDx organization TEDxAmherst, a 501(c)(3) non profit that acts as a fiscal sponsor for local TEDx organizations, a computer science mentoring group for incoming freshman, and PALs (People Against Loneliness) - a coalition that started at the beginning of the pandemic to connect with diverse people and share ideas.
In addition to this, Ruby also works as a Jr. Product Manager specializing in UX/UI design at Ompractice - a Western Massachusetts based startup that provides online interactive yoga memberships. She also just begun working on a startup called BidSicily that provides an auction platform for the auctioning off one euro houses in old Italian cities as a way to revitalize the towns' economies. Recently, Ruby's interested have been in advocating for more humane technology, UX/UI design, organizational culture, education reform, and gender equality.
In her free time Ruby is an avid runner, hiker, mountain biker, cross country skier, and yogi. She likes to spend time creating digital and physical art, solve Rubik's cubes, and building Rube Goldberg machines to water her plants. Ruby also just started a cooking blog on Instagram called @v3ganish that consists of pictures and recipes of food she likes to cook. Entrepreneurship and creating things is something Ruby is extremely passionate about and she sees herself creating plenty of companies and organizations in her future.
